Boomeranging: Expat to Repat
boomeranging
47 episodes
9 months ago
A podcast that explores the question: What could be so hard about returning home after years living overseas? In each episode, Margot Andersen sits down with a former Aussie expat to discuss how they survived repatriation and reverse culture shock. How they navigated the logistics of career, friends and family to successfully find their new place at home... and all without losing their global spirit!

S6 Ep7: Adam Ford
Boomeranging: Expat to Repat
38 minutes 25 seconds
1 year ago
S6 Ep7: Adam Ford
Adam Ford describes his approach to the job market after coming home as ‘pretty proactive because I knew it was going to be pretty difficult’.   Adam was coming home to Australia with a North American finance career but what he really wanted was a role in the for-purpose sector.  To achieve this, he knew he had to convince a parochial hiring market NOT to put him in the finance box.   Fast forward a few short years and Adam has successfully swapped boxes.    He now leads the International Association of Privacy Professionals in Australia and New Zealand.   In this podcast, we talk about how Adam has ‘relaunched’ himself a number of times in his career in both the US and in Australia to align with his changing interests and as part of a dual career family.   This is a great discussion for expats who want to come home and want to pivot their career.    Going from a small fish in a large pond, to a larger fish in a somewhat smaller pond sounds like a good idea, until you are that fish.  Adam talks through his strategy of taking what could look like a sideways step on the surface, but really was the step that helped him rebuild and pivot to the professional and personal life that he loves right now.
